Nectarine and Raspberry Smoothie

Historically, nectarines are believed to be a mutation of peaches, cherished for their smooth skin and sweet flavor, while raspberries have been enjoyed since ancient times for their rich taste and health benefits. Ingredients
- Ice cubes
- 1 cup
- Almond milk
- 1 cup, unsweetened
- Honey
- 1-2 tablespoons, to taste
- Greek yogurt
- 1/2 cup
- Raspberries
- 1 cup, fresh or frozen
- Nectarines
- 2, pitted and chopped
Instructions
- Begin by gathering all your ingredients: nectarines, raspberries, Greek yogurt, honey, almond milk, and ice cubes.
- In a blender, combine the chopped nectarines, raspberries, Greek yogurt, honey, almond milk, and ice cubes.
- Blend on high speed until the mixture is smooth and creamy, making sure to pause and scrape down the sides if necessary.
- Taste the smoothie and adjust the sweetness by adding more honey if desired, blending again to incorporate.
- Pour the smoothie into glasses and serve immediately, garnishing with a few whole raspberries or a slice of nectarine on the rim for an extra touch.
Tips
- For added nutrition, consider adding a handful of spinach or kale for a green smoothie variation without compromising flavor.
- If you're looking for a thicker consistency, use frozen nectarines or raspberries instead of fresh fruit.
- Feel free to substitute honey with maple syrup or agave nectar for a vegan-friendly option.
